Tóm tắt:
This paper investigates the nonlinear vibration responses of porous graphene platelet reinforced composite (PGPLRC) circular plates and spherical caps with stepped spiderweb stiffeners resting on elastic foundations and under harmonic external pressure in the thermal environment. The material properties of both the shell skin and the spiderweb stiffeners are assumed to be graded in the thickness direction according to the continuous change of the foam volume fractions. Governing equations are based on Donnell shell theory, taking into account von Karman nonlinearities, initial imperfection, and visco-elastic foundation. Approximate solutions can be chosen in polynomial forms, and the Euler–Lagrange equations are applied to derive nonlinear motion equations of structures. The Runge–Kutta method is applied, and the time-amplitude vibration behavior can be obtained; meanwhile, the fundamental frequencies are explicitly investigated. The effects of geometrical, material, foundation parameters, and stepped spiderweb stiffeners on the nonlinear vibration behavior of PGPLRC circular plates and spherical caps with stepped spiderweb stiffeners are investigated and discussed in detail. The results demonstrate that the effectiveness of the spiderweb stiffeners and suitable porosity distribution significantly improves the stiffness and vibration resistance of the structures. The effectiveness and reliability of the present approach in analyzing nonlinear vibration responses of the considered structures with intricate material and geometry can also be observed.
